Can someone else use my seller's permit/resale number for their small business to purchase products?

They are a very small business in a different industry and not likely to grow big anytime soon. Is it going to be a problem if I lend them my number?

No. This is an improper use of a resale certificate. Such a use can result in penalties, revocation of your sales certificate, and, in addition to civil penalties, is a misdemeanor criminal offense.
